As a Software Engineer at CloudBees, you will be an essential contributor to the development of our industry-leading software products. You'll work within the CloudBees Continuous Integration collaborative team environment to design, develop, and deliver high-quality solutions that empower our customers to achieve seamless and efficient software delivery.


What You’ll Do

Design, develop, and maintain DevOps solutions that enable organizations to streamline their software development and delivery processes. This includes creating tools, plugins, and integrations that enhance the capabilities of the CloudBees product suite.

Implement best practices for code quality, automated testing, and code reviews to ensure software reliability and performance. Write unit tests, integration tests, and perform code reviews to maintain high standards.

Work on new feature development and product enhancements based on customer feedback and industry trends. Continuously innovate and propose improvements to existing software solutions

Analyze and address complex technical challenges and issues that arise during the software development lifecycle. Debug, troubleshoot, and resolve technical problems efficiently.

Create and maintain technical documentation, including design specifications, user guides, and best practice guidelines. Share knowledge and contribute to internal and external technical communities.

Participate in Agile ceremonies, such as sprint planning, stand-up meetings, and retrospectives. Collaborate with product managers, designers, and other engineers to ensure alignment and efficient project execution.
